Position Summary
Our Recruiting & Retention Department has an exciting opportunity for a Recruiting Coordinator to join our team! The Recruiting Coordinator will support the Firms Recruiting & Retention efforts and will be responsible for coordinating interviews, screening applications and sourcing candidates for opportunities as well as preparing and posting job advertisements on the Firm website and various job boards. Other duties will include assisting the Recruiting & Retention team with miscellaneous administrative and strategic projects as needed.
Essential Functions
Assist in scheduling interviews with candidates, including working with our attorneys and hiring managers to gain availability, following up and compiling feedback and checking in with applicants to ensure a positive candidate experience
Provide administrative support, including creating/maintaining files, preparing correspondence
Coordinate candidate interviews, exit interviews, and check-in calls
Respond to and direct candidate inquiries
Monitor and track recruitment metrics, including but not limited to diversity statistics, candidate submissions and headhunter usage
Respond to a broad range of recruitment inquiries including but not limited to internal inquiries.
Responsible for sending exit surveys and scheduling exit interviews as necessary
Miscellaneous administrative tasks and strategic projects as assigned

Firm Overview Ogletree Deakins is one of the largest labor and employment law firms representing management in all types of employment-related legal matters. Best Law Firms® has named Ogletree Deakins a “Law Firm of the Year” for 14 consecutive years. In the 2025 edition, the publication named Ogletree Deakins its “Law Firm of the Year” in the Litigation – Labor and Employment category. Ogletree Deakins has more than 1,100 attorneys located in 60 offices across the United States and in Europe, Canada, and Mexico. The firm represents a diverse range of clients, including many of the Fortune 50 companies in the U.S.
